About 3,4-dimethylphenol;hydrofluoride

3,4-dimethylphenol;hydrofluoride (PubChem CID 163210270) has the molecular formula C8H11FO and a molecular weight of 142.17 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 3,4-dimethylphenol;hydrofluoride.
